      She has low Testosterone levels which lead to low estrogen and low DHT . If she has under 20ngdl of TT Level then shes gonna be tired most of the time as well as having low libido and intercourse can be painful for her due to less vaginal lubrication . Id also like to know her FSH and LH levels as well as her Progesterone .

      Testosterone therapy works incredibly well for females as they are very Androgen Sensitive, so as little as 10 mgs weekly of a Test Cyp/Enanth injection will boost her estrogen levels and her DHT too , but she can also get a prescription for a combo of Testosterone/Estrogen topical cream .

      Also check her Thyroid markers : TSH , T3 and T4 as these are a major metabolic player .

      My wife is on HRT, post menopausal. The part of life a woman is in is important in the way the three main hormones are dosed, as in timing.

      We started ourselves with Test C, with seemingly great results to start with. After a while we realised it was way more complicated that a man, so she went to a doctor.
      The doctors were great and sorted the Progesterone and E by prescription but indicated the injections were the best way so we should keep that up, however the dose was too high.
      So we reduced and went to bi weekly but the bloods stayed high.
      We decided to go to Test P and back to once a week. The levels reduced a lot after a couple of weeks, so we increased the dose and it got a little cyclic.
      We then went back to biweekly and have been getting better blood results.(still a little cyclic but seems fine)
      Im not sure of all these other types of AAS but our idea is use bio- identical hormones (all three) and get the three levels back in the normal range, that way your wife will improve if the issue is hormone imbalance.
      You should help by logging her doses and intervals, record her comments and feelings, make sure its consistent.
      To start with get blood tests often.
      Our relationship has blossomed as we are both on HRT, sex life is better, we enjoy each others humour and company more, and have more resistance to stress.

      Long esters are no good for women, if you dose too high you want it to clear as quickly as possible. Short esters more frequent doses.
      Also run a half-life spreadsheet and record everything.

      She needs blood work. Total testosterone, TSH/Free T4/Free T3 to start with.


      Women have about 10% the serum levels that men do. So the average healthy female level is about 50 ng/dL (10% of the average male's 500 ng/dL). It can vary depending on genetics, menstrual cycle phase, lifestyle, etc.


      A female HRT dose of injectable testosterone would be anywhere from 10-20 mg per week (Again that's 10% of the male HRT dose). The goal is the bring up total testosterone, many HRT docs will bring women up as high as 150 ng/dL. Side effect sensitivity and virilization is genetic, some women can blast high doses and can stay feminine and other women are manly without touching a drop of AAS.


      Benefits of female testosterone replacement therapy include increased sex drive, energy, well-being and confidence. Creams and pellets work too, bad there are more draw back.


      Creams can get on kids and have to be applied daily, sometimes absorption is poor and titrating dose is not as easy as changing testosterone cyp dosage on the fly. Pellets require an in office procedure and if the dose is too high, you are stuck with the pellets or have to get them removed, again, a literal pain in the ass. Injections are the cheapest and most convenient. Creams tend to convert to DHT more due to higher levels of 5-alpha reductase on the skin

      Hormonal birth control is a common cause of female low testosterone and it's been linked to long-term SHBG increases. Lower libido is one of the most common side effects as well weight gain and mood swings.
